RECALLING Article 28(b) of the Convention on the International
Maritime Organization concerning the functions of the Committee,
RECALLING ALSO resolution A.689(17) entitled "Testing of
life-saving appliances", by which the Assembly, at its seventeenth
session, adopted the Recommendation on testing of life-saving appliances,
RECALLING FURTHER that the Assembly, when adopting resolution
A.689(17), authorized the Committee to keep the Recommendation on
testing of life-saving appliances under review and to adopt, when
appropriate, amendments thereto,
NOTING resolution MSC.81(70),
by which, at its seventieth session, it adopted the Revised recommendation
on testing of life-saving appliances, introducing more precise provisions
for the testing of life-saving appliances based on the requirements
of the International Life-Saving Appliances (LSA) Code,
RECOGNIZING the need to appropriately align the relevant
provisions of the Revised recommendation on testing of life-saving
appliances with the associated amendments to the LSA Code adopted
by resolution MSC.320(89),
HAVING CONSIDERED, at its eighty-ninth session, proposed
amendments to the Revised recommendation on testing of life-saving
appliances, prepared by the Sub-Committee on Ship Design and Equipment
at its fifty-fifth session,
1. ADOPTS amendments to the Revised recommendation
on testing of life-saving appliances (resolution
MSC.81(70)), the text of which is set out in the Annex to the
present resolution;
2. RECOMMENDS Governments to apply the annexed
amendments when testing life-saving appliances.
